[PATCH v5 47/50] multi-process: Enable support for multiple devices in remote |
Date: |
Mon, 24 Feb 2020 15:55:38 -0500 |
From: Elena Ufimtseva <address@hidden>
Add support to allow multiple devices to be configured in the
remote process
Signed-off-by: Elena Ufimtseva <address@hidden>
Signed-off-by: John G Johnson <address@hidden>
Signed-off-by: Jagannathan Raman <address@hidden>
---
hw/proxy/qemu-proxy.c | 4 ++-
include/hw/proxy/qemu-proxy.h | 3 +++
include/io/mpqemu-link.h | 1 +
qdev-monitor.c | 2 ++
remote/remote-main.c | 62 +++++++++++++++++++++++++++++++++++--------
5 files changed, 60 insertions(+), 12 deletions(-)
